So not so soon after Xbox Microsoft Developer Direct, there was a interview done with the Fable devs. One section has caught the attention of many.


So, we talk about how our morality system is more about shades of gray. It's more about the subjectivity of morality that honestly we see in the world today. There's no objective good, there's no objective evil. You couldn't get everyone in the world to agree that something is evil or something is good. That just doesn't happen.
In other words, you won't see a halo or horns growing.

I mean I guess what they are saying is technically true, but I feel it could've been done so that only we, the players, see the changes in appearance. Then again, it might be weird to see none of the NPCs comment on your appearance.

Game Devs Skipping GDC 2026 Over ICE Concerns, US Safety Fears

An interviewed person stated the four most frequently cited reasons for skipping out:
  1. San Francisco being perceived as "unpleasant and expensive"
  2. A desire to protest the U.S. government's aggression towards their countries
  3. Concerns about being required to disclose social media activity upon entering the country
  4. Personal safety fears related to the actions of U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ement
